Kitchen Operations Supervisor

Here’s what you’ll do during a typical day:

  • Supervise daily back of house operations: Oversee utility stewards, dishwashers, and temporary staff to ensure timely transport and cleaning of utensils and serviceware for restaurant and banquet operations
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ization: Supervise cleaning of back-of-house spaces to uphold sanitation and hygiene standards
  • Support inventory and equipment needs: Ensure proper inventory levels, manage equipment storage and distribution, and coordinate the timely delivery of food and equipment for all functions
  • Support team performance and development: Assist with day-to-day team oversight, scheduling shifts, coaching and professional development, conducting evaluations, and recognizing achievements
  • Monitor and report on performance metrics: Track breakage and loss reports, update operating manuals, and assist with monthly inventories to support cost controls and efficiency improvements
  • Collaborate across teams: Partner with kitchen, bar, and restaurant teams to ensure seamless service, assisting team members where needed
  • Uphold regulatory standards: Maintain compliance with health, safety, sanitation, and alcohol awareness regulations, ensuring the highest standards of guest and team member wellbeing
